GREYHAWKS

|
I joined Deerhound Club in 1984 having carefully
treasured a picture of a Deerhound for years out of a lurcher
book telling everyone who'd listen that one day my dream of
owning a Deerhound would come true.
Having owned deerhound x lurchers for years
it was at a country fair I was approached by a couple of club
members who spotted my club badge. This led me to my first Deerhound
“Bonnie” a rescue bitch, who fulfilled all my dreams
and planted the seeds of the love affair with the breed. My
first puppy was Pharcourse Cellan who hated the show ring. Over
the last 20 years many hounds and puppies have graced my home,
its been a fantastic life and I'm still searching for the perfect
Deerhound, and to help and support people new to the breed.
Mrs Glenis Pink - (nee Darey)
